- The distance between Asmara, Eritrea and Santa Barbara, Ca, Usa is approximately 14,098 km or 8,760 mi.
- To reach Asmara in this distance one would set out from Santa Barbara, Ca bearing 25.7°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Asmara bearing 158.1° or SSE .
- Asmara has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Santa Barbara, Ca has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b).
- The mean temperature is 0.5 °C (0.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.8 °C (6.8°F) less in Asmara.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 105.9 mm (4.2 in) more which is equivalent to 105.9 l/m² (2.6 US gal/ft²) or 1,059,000 l/ha (113,214 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 15.6° higher in Asmara than in Santa Barbara, Ca.
